A Blonde for a Night (1928)

A Blonde for a Night (1928) poster

After an argument, a newlywed decides to test her husband's fidelity by disguising herself as a blonde.

Director: E. Mason Hopper, F. McGrew Willis
Genre: Comedy
Runtime: 54 min
